Detailed Features and Historical Significance: Manufactured in 1918, the Smith & Wesson Model 1917 was pivotal during its time, designed specifically to meet the exigent demands of World War I. This model chambers the powerful .45 ACP cartridge, facilitating ammunition uniformity across service pistols. It features a 5.5-inch barrel with a pinned feature, enhancing the revolver's structural integrity. The double-action/single-action (DA/SA) mechanism provides a versatile shooting experience, from quick follow-up shots to precise single-shot engagements. The blued finish not only protects the gun but also provides a timeless look enhanced by the checkered walnut grips adorned with iconic S&W medallions.
The sight system, comprising a half-moon front blade and a grooved rear sight, offers reliable accuracy essential for both the historical combat it was part of and contemporary recreational shooting.
